Juventus keen on Icardi, Belfodil

Italian newspaper Tuttosport understands that Juventus are planning a summer assault on two Serie A hotshots.

The Bianconeri were hoping to sign a world-class striker in the January transfer window, but having failed to negotiate a deal for Lisandro Lopez, club officials decided to alter their transfer strategy.

Rather than splashing the cash on high-profile players, Beppe Marotta plans to sign several talented youngsters that offer the best value for money.

Having said that, the Bianconeri have already agreed to sign Sampdoria midfielder Andrea Poli for the 2013/2014 season, but that doesn’t mean their shopping in Genoa is over.

According to Tuttosport, Juventus are keen on Samp youngster Mauro Icardi and were delighted to see Napoli’s deadline day bid for the Argentine rejected.

The Old Lady hope to lower the €12 million asking price by including Paolo De Ceglie or Simone Padoin in the deal.

They have in mind a similar arrangement for Parma forward Ishak Belfodil, who was linked with deadline day swap with Fabio Quagliarella.
